Drs. Kenneth A. Arndt and Jeffrey S. Dover have assembled over 30 laser authorities from around the world to present the latest information on the most interesting and challenging areas in the field of cutaneous and aesthetic laser surgery.
Reflecting material discussed at the annual advanced seminar "Controversies and Conversations in Cutaneous Laser Surgery," this unique text presents cutting-edge information that reflects not only the material presented but the exciting interchange of ideas among these world-class experts.
You will find the newest information about laser surgery including:
-Laser resurfacing -Photorejuvenation -Treatment of vascular anomalies and leg veins -Lasers compared with the scalpel and diamond knife -Skin cooling -Lasers as diagnostic tools -Treatment of psoriasis and scars -Novel approaches to skin rejuvenation
